Lexmark has manufactured a total of 32 different models of all-in-one printers. Some of these printers are capable of using their copier function even if not connected to a PC. All of the printers follow the same naming convention of an X (or, in two cases, a P) with several numbers after it, from the X63 to the X5250.

Drivers are usually found on the manufacturers web site. They are sometimes updated, for example when a new operating system is introduced, and can be downloaded free of charge
